Nope. There's no PC engine reimplementation that can play that game either at the moment.DCmad wrote:Any DC interpreter can play Gabriel Knight - Sin of the Fathers?
The subversion daily builds of ScummVM now have support for the Sierra AGI engine as well. You can grab that at my ScummVM for Dreamcast Support Page:

No, Torin's Passage is not supported.
And from the Quest for Glory series, only the EGA version of part 1 is supported.
(It's unlikely that the same thing will happen with FreeSCI, in case anyone was wondering.)

Yes, basically the Sarien project has been imported by ScummVM (with the permission of the authors, even though this is not strictly necessary).MetaFox wrote:The subversion daily builds of ScummVM now have support for the Sierra AGI engine as well.
(It's unlikely that the same thing will happen with FreeSCI, in case anyone was wondering.)
